As long as you have a REAL GN Yes the gears will fit the 8.5. If someone swapped rear for a regular G-body rear end which is a 7.5 they will not fit the 7.5 rear. Covers pictured left is 10 bolt 8.5 the right is the 7.5 cover

If you suspect that the car still has the original gears there is a two digit code stamped in the right side axle tube. Depending on corrosion, paint, undercoat, etc. It may be difficult to locate and read the original stamping. If it is a limited slip you can rotate the wheel once and count the rotations of the driveshaft. BUT, best way is to pull cover and find the teeth count of ring gear and pinion either by counting or finding the markings. Adding the appropriate carrier will convert your standard rear to limited slip when you also do the gears. You will also need an install kit when doing so.
